My Buying Guides on Pioneer Woman Coffee Cups
Why I Like Pioneer Woman Coffee Cups
When I look for coffee cups, I want something that feels cheerful, practical, and durable. Pioneer Woman coffee cups usually stand out to me because of their colorful floral designs and cozy farmhouse style. I also like that they can make my morning coffee feel a little more special.
What I Check Before Buying
Before I buy any Pioneer Woman coffee cup, I always look at a few important things. I check the size, material, handle comfort, and whether the cup is microwave and dishwasher safe. I also pay attention to how the design looks in person, because I want something that fits my kitchen style.
Size and Capacity
For me, size matters a lot. Some days I want a small cup for a quick coffee, while other days I want a larger mug for tea, cocoa, or a big latte. I usually choose based on how much I drink in one sitting. If I like a fuller mug, I go for a larger capacity.
Material and Durability
I prefer coffee cups that feel sturdy in my hand. Pioneer Woman coffee cups are often made from ceramic, which I like because it keeps drinks warm and feels solid. I always make sure the cup seems thick enough for daily use, especially if I plan to use it often.
Design and Style
One of the biggest reasons I choose Pioneer Woman cups is the design. I enjoy the bright colors, vintage-inspired patterns, and floral details. My advice is to pick a style that matches your kitchen or your personality. I like cups that feel both decorative and functional.
Comfort of the Handle
I never ignore the handle. If the handle is too small or awkward, the cup becomes less enjoyable to use. I always check whether I can hold it comfortably, even when the cup is full and warm. A good handle makes a big difference in daily use.
Microwave and Dishwasher Safety
Convenience matters to me, so I always check if the cup is microwave and dishwasher safe. I want to reheat my coffee without worry and clean the cup easily after use. If a cup needs too much special care, I usually skip it.
